With school just around the corner, there’s a big piece of the puzzle that’s still missing for the Wichita Public Schools Board of Education. What will its gating criteria be? The BOE is expected to discuss and vote on this during its 6 p.m. meeting Thursday. Gating is simply a set of metrics that districts put in place and use to determine when and how schools will operate, depending on how bad COVID-19 is in the area. “We went through three different matrices, which was through the KNEA, the Kansas Department of Education, and then Sedgwick County. And so we use those as guidance to basically create our own gating criteria,” said Ron Rosales, Wichita BOE District 6.
